Transaction 17dd44523be1a907edf593c9677def1ef7a367ca88907d354975c0fe89aafa5e
1 Input
1 Output
-
17dd44523be1a907edf593c9677def1ef7a367ca88907d354975c0fe89aafa5e:0
- value
- 475515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3ac4b204504cf54b4ba649f6ec758e75ad55367 OP_EQUAL
- address
- 3KXe67M5jeAU33owNWEPnwseufBra1Su9D